Men's Tennis Signs Judson Blair to NLI

Judson_Blair_WEBJudson_Blair_WEB

SAN DIEGO – San Diego State men's tennis head coach Gene Carswell has proudly announced the signing of Judson Blair to a National Letter of Intent.

A prep senior at Sprague High School in Salem, Oregon, Blair will be eligible to compete for the Aztecs beginning with the 2020-21 campaign.

"We are very excited to welcome Judson to the Aztec family," Carswell said. "He is one of the top players emerging in the West with a great work ethic and natural leadership abilities. His bright star is on the rise and we look forward to his arrival on campus next fall."

Blair was tabbed a four-star recruit by TennisRecruiting.net and is ranked fourth in the Pacific Northwest by the website. In addition, he currently owns a Universal Tennis Rating (UTR) of 12 and finds himself at No. 29 in the latest USTA national standings.

Last month, Blair finished third in singles play at the USTA Boys' 18 National Indoor Championships in Overland Park, Kansas, after winning the USTA National Level Three Tournament held Sept. 21-23 in Lakewood, California.

Blair, who was named the Mid-Valley Player of the Year on two occasions by the Salem Statesman Journal, also advanced to the title match of the Oregon School Activities Association (OSAA) 6A Boys Singles Championships last spring after entering as the tournament's No. 2 seed.

Blair, who plans to major in business at SDSU, additionally drew interest from Iowa, Michigan State, Alabama, Chattanooga and Lipscomb during the recruiting process.
